Procedure:

1.  Prepare pudding according to package directions and cool.
2.  Slice the pound cake & spread 1/2 the slices with the jam - top with other halves.
3.  Cut each "sandwich" into quarters & arrange some over bottom of dish.
4.  Drain peaches and arrange around sides of dish.
5.  Combine sherry and peach juice and pour over pound cake.
6.  Cover with a layer of pudding.
7.  Repeat layers.
8.  Spoon La Creme over top, sprinkle with almonds.
9.  Refrigerate. 

Serve & enjoy!!

Looks so pretty in a Trifle dish!

Can be made with homemade custard, ladyfingers, etc.....whatever you want, but this is simple and so good!
